What is China’s Snow Theme Park?

Located in the heart of China, this snow theme park spans over acres of land and features a wide range of attractions and‍ activities for visitors of all ages. From snow tubing ⁤and⁣ ice skating to snowball ⁣fights and⁢ snowman building, there is ⁢no shortage of fun to be had at this winter wonderland.

Attractions at the Snow Theme Park

  • Snow Tubing: Zoom down the snow-covered hills on inflatable tubes for an exhilarating ride.
  • Ice Skating: Glide across the ice on a picturesque ice skating rink under the open sky.
  • Snowball ⁢Fights: Engage in friendly competition with family and friends with ​epic snowball fights.
  • Snowman Building: Get ⁣creative and build your own snowman to add to the winter magic.
  • Winter Carnivals: Enjoy ⁤live performances, hot cocoa, and festive decorations at the winter carnival.

China’s Harbin Ice and Snow⁣ World project has recently achieved the remarkable feat of becoming ⁤the world’s largest indoor ice and⁣ snow theme park, ⁤as confirmed by Guinness World Records.​ This park, known as “Little Ice and Snow World”, is a captivating ‍indoor ice and snow pavilion that offers visitors a truly immersive ​and interactive experience. ⁢By employing cutting-edge ice-carving and snow-building techniques, technologies, and skills, this theme park is dedicated‍ to promoting the normalization of ice and snow tourism throughout the entire year, transforming Harbin into a year-round destination that caters to both locals and tourists.

The Evolution of Harbin’s Winter Tourism Landscape

Spanning an impressive 23,800 square meters, the park is ingeniously divided into 13 distinct experience projects and nine themed​ areas. Through the integration of state-of-the-art sound and light effects, visitors are treated ⁤to an array of interactive and entertaining elements, coupled with cultural representations revolving⁢ around light, shadows, ice, and snow.

Consider the novelty of experiencing ⁢winter in the midst of scorching summer temperatures! The artfully crafted exhibits and displays within the world’s largest indoor ice and snow theme park perfectly replicate the enchanting essence of a winter wonderland, all while maintaining a ⁢frosty temperature ranging ⁣from -8 to -12°C, contrasting starkly against the blazing⁤ 29°C heatwave ​often experienced in Harbin, China.

The ice utilized‍ in every corner of this versatile theme ⁢park is sourced directly from the Songhua‍ River, boasting ⁣a total ice volume of 20,000 cubic ⁤meters. Noteworthy is the use of edible colour pigments in the creation of vibrantly colored⁤ ice sculptures depicting ​various objects⁤ such as cakes, fruits, and ice cream, showcasing a commitment to environmentally friendly practices.

Harbin, designated as the capital of China’s Heilongjiang​ province, has earned‌ the moniker of Ice City due to⁣ its lengthy, snow-covered winters and brief, mild summers. ⁢An annual highlight is the Harbin‌ Ice and Snow Festival, a spectacular event ⁣running from ⁤December to early March. Beyond the ice​ and snow ⁤attractions, Harbin also boasts a range of other interesting sites including⁢ Zhaolin Park, Jile Temple, Yabuli Ski Resort, Sun ⁢Island, Siberia Tiger Park, and Heilongjiang Museum.
